New Oliver Jeffers book scheduled to come out Oct. 4
NEW YORK (AP) — A new book by the million-selling children’s author and visual artist Oliver Jeffers is a blend of art and science and adventure. Jeffers’ “Meanwhile Back on Earth” will be published Oct. 4, according to Philomel Books, an imprint of Penguin Young Readers. The book was inspired by an art installation called “Our Place in Space,” a sculpture trail and scale model of the solar system the Irish author worked on with astrophysicist Professor Stephen Smartt among others. It opens in the United Kingdom this spring. Jeffers’ previous books include “Here We Are: Notes for Living on Planet Earth,” “Stuck” and “Lost and Found.”
